JAKARTA - The Charta Politica Survey Institute released the results of a survey related to PDIP's electability if it does not carry Ganjar Pranowo, who is a cadre as a presidential candidate in the 2024 presidential election.

As a result, PDIP's electability decreases if it does not carry Ganjar.

Executive Director of Charta Politica Indonesia, Yunarto Wijaya, said that his party carried out a simulation involving 200 respondents who were PDIP and Ganjar voters.

The results showed that only 54.5 percent said they would still choose PDIP if Ganjar was not nominated by PDIP as a presidential candidate.

"As many as 31 percent of PDIP and Ganjar Pranowo voters said they would not vote for PDIP if Ganjar Pranowo was not nominated by PDIP," Yunarto said at a press conference on the results of a survey themed 'Persepsi Publik Regarding Government Performance and the Latest Electoral Map', Tuesday 29 November.

Meanwhile, respondents who did not know or did not answer were 14.5 percent.

Based on the latest survey, PDIP's electability is currently at 21.7 percent. Then followed by Gerindra at 14.5 percent; Golkar (9.8 percent); PKB (8.5 percent); Democrats (7.3 percent); PKS (6.9 percent), NasDem (6 percent); PAN (4 percent), PPP (3.6 percent), and PPP (3.6 percent).

On the other hand, Yunarto said that as many as 87.5 percent of PDIP and Ganjar voters stated that they still chose Ganjar Pranowo even though it was not nominated by PDIP.

"There are only 5 percent who did not choose Ganjar Pranowo and 7.5 percent did not know or did not answer," he said.

It is known that Ganjar Pranowo's electability is at the top even though Anies Baswedan has been declared a presidential candidate by NasDem. In the simulation of 10 names, Ganjar's electability reached 32.6 percent.

Ganjar, who is currently the Governor of Central Java for two terms, is a landslide ahead of Anies Baswedan, who only has 23.1 percent electability. Meanwhile, Prabowo is in third position with 22 percent.

In the simulation of three names, Yunarto said that Ganjar was again in the top position with an electability of 37.4 percent. Then followed by Anies by 29.3 percent and Prabowo by 25.3 percent.

The Charta Politica Indonesia survey was held on November 4 - 12, 2022. This survey used the multistage random sampling method with face-to-face interviews.

The sample in this survey consists of 1,220 spread across provinces with a minimum criteria of 17 years or already meeting voter requirements. The margin of error from this survey is 2.83 percent.
